Quite the Lucky Goat I am to have found Goodies Eatery on College Avenue in Tallahassee, Florida.
In all actuality, I have eaten at Goodies Eatery on a handful of occasions when visiting the state capitol. Fast, friendly and polite service - they deliver as well.
For breakfast I typically order the bacon, egg, and cheese bagel at $4.09. As for coffee, it's the Lucky Goat in several different varieties. Eating in, your coffee is served in a ceramic mug. Taking it "to go" - your coffee is served in a "to go" cup.
When ordering lunch, it's usually the Gobble Goodie, which is sliced turkey breast on whole wheat, topped with lettuce, tomato, cucumber, sprouts and veggie spread at $6.25. I'm a cheapskate, so it's water as my beverage. That's free.
Convenient downtown location near the state capitol. Parking is tight, but as I mentioned - they deliver. I know this because they have delivered to my hotel on two separate occasions. Turn around time was about 25 minutes. Not bad.
